Investigation Summary

Investigation Nr: 129316.015
Event: 09/03/2020
Employee fractures and lacerates leg in fall from ladder dur

At 1:45 p.m. on September 3, 2020, an employee working as a laborer for a construction contractor was installing soldier pile wall beams on the hill side of a roadway. The crew had set an I-beam inside a hole utilizing rigging. The employee leaned an extension ladder against the beam preparing to access the top to remove the rigging. Two coworkers were holding the ladder in place while the employee was climbed the ladder. The employee was approximately 4 to 5 feet up the ladder when the beam move causing the ladder and employee to fall to the ground. The employee was hospitalized to treat a fracture and laceration to his leg.
